K
K
Kirill Gopienko2020-12-21 10:47:07
Java
Kirill Gopienko, 2020-12-21 10:47:07

How to search by id in a bank card?

UserCard<String, Integer> UserCard1 = new UserCard<>();
UserCard1.setNameUser("Гопиенко Кирилл Алексеевич");
UserCard1.setId("IQWE123");
UserCard1.setmoney(3200);

UserCard<String, Integer> UserCard2 = new UserCard<>();
UserCard2.setNameUser("Холод Виталий Виталиевич");
UserCard2.setId("POI098");
UserCard2.setmoney(4500);

UserCard<String, Integer> UserCard3 = new UserCard<>();
UserCard3.setNameUser("Богатый Рич Ричардев");
UserCard3.setId("ZXC567");
UserCard3.setmoney(7800);

//Есть у нас 3 пользователя, у каждого из них свой айди, имя и фамилия.
//Нужно сделать так что бы пользователя можно было найти через айди. 
//К примеру мне нужны данные пользователя номер 3(ФИО, кредитный счет, сумма на карте)

Answer the question

In order to leave comments, you need to log in

1 answer(s)
O
Orkhan, 2020-12-21
@BlinkLinger

The simple solution is
1) collect all UserCards into a collection. For example, List<UserCard>
2) Using a scanner, get the card id, and then run it through a loop List<UserCard>
UserCard uc : userCardList
3) if it matches, output the result

Didn't find what you were looking for?

Ask your question

Ask a Question

731 491 924 answers to any question